Kotlin QA Engineer

Категория обучения:
Kotlin QA Engineer
Формат курса:
Онлайн-занятия, Домашние задания, Обратная связь кураторов, Чат студентов
Есть рассрочка платежа:
Да
Трудоустройство:
Нет
Поделиться с друзьями:
Особенности курса:
Знания и практический опыт разработки тестов и рефакторинга кроссплатформенных приложений на языке Kotlin для мобильных, веб-платформ, систем Enterprise-уровня и решений для встраиваемых систем.
Для кого подойдет курс:

Курс рассчитан на разработчиков на любом ООП-языке программирования с опытом работы от 1 года, желающих улучшить свои навыки в автоматизации тестирования и создании CI/CD, либо тестировщиков с опытом работы от 1 года, которые хотели бы научиться создавать автоматические тесты для всех уровней приложения (включая интеграционные тесты).

Описание курса:

Какие навыки получат студенты на курсе?

  • Использование актуальных возможностей Kotlin для создания максимально полного покрытия тестами сложных многокомпонентных приложений (в том числе с графическим интерфейсом).
  • Создание тестовых данных и использование инъекции зависимостей для подмены объектов при выполнении тестирования.
  • Уверенное понимание и применение механизмов синхронизации при тестировании асинхронных компонентов и распределенных систем.
  • Выполнение нагрузочного тестирования, автоматических тестов на наличие уязвимостей, проверки соответствия стиля кода принятым правилам.
  • Владение основными системами сборки приложений и встраивания автоматизированного тестирования в конвейер сборки в наиболее востребованных системах непрерывной интеграции.
Онлайн-школа
Преимущества обучения: Программы обучение для трех уровней сложности: от новичков до профессионалов; Программы разработаны с учетом требований IT-рынка; Преподаватели знакомы не только с теорией, но и являются практиками в своей сфере; Занятия проходят в онлайн-формате; Нацеленность на получение практических навыков; Разработка выпускного проекта, который можно добавить в своё портфолио; Быстра...
000
0.0
0.0
0.0
0.0
Нет отзывов. Напишите отзыв первым!
Нет комментариев. Ваш будет первым!
Также рекомендуем посмотреть курсы
Хотите освоить новую профессию? Выберите наиболее подходящие для вас курсы, прочитав реальные отзывы!
Профессия Machine Learning Engineer
Есть рассрочка платежа:
Да
Трудоустройство:
Да
Научитесь создавать модели ML и обучать нейронные сети. Освоите анализ данных и в конце курса выберете одну из специализаций: обработку естественного языка или Computer Vision.
Data Engineer с нуля до Junior
Есть рассрочка платежа:
Да
Трудоустройство:
Да
Вы научитесь разворачивать инфраструктуру для сбора, преобразования и загрузки больших данных, освоите Python и SQL. Начнёте с основ, а через год сможете найти работу Junior-специалистом.
Python QA Engineer
Есть рассрочка платежа:
Да
Трудоустройство:
Нет
Изучение автоматизации тестирования: фреймворк pytest, автоматизация интерфейсов UI и API, чтобы быть максимально универсальным специалистом.
Kotlin Backend Developer. Professional
Есть рассрочка платежа:
Да
Трудоустройство:
Нет
Обзорно-практический курс. В нем вы прикоснетесь к большому числу инструментов разработки современных, гибких, высокопроизводительных серверных приложений на языке Kotlin.
QA Engineer. Basic
Есть рассрочка платежа:
Да
Трудоустройство:
Нет
Получите навыки тестирования веб-приложений и представления обратной связи о качестве продукта
Reverse-Engineering
Есть рассрочка платежа:
Да
Трудоустройство:
Нет
Научитесь находить и исправлять уязвимости своих систем и приложений. Единственный практический курс на российском рынке

Тестировщик — это технический специалист, который специализируется на тестировании компьютерного оборудования и программного обеспечения. Он отвечает за то, чтобы компьютерная система работала так, как задумано.

IT-тестер отвечает за создание и выполнение подробных планов тестирования. Эти планы описывают тесты, которые будут выполняться в компьютерной системе, прежде чем она будет запущена в производство.

Существует два типа IT-тестировщика — аппаратные или программные.
  • Аппаратный тестер — это человек, который тестирует периферийные устройства компьютера. К таким устройствам обычно относятся компьютеры, клавиатуры, мониторы, принтеры и мобильные устройства.
  • Программный тестировщик тестирует различные компьютерные прикладные программы и приложения.

Кроме того, иногда IT-тестер должен обеспечить работу нового оборудования со старыми кабелями и периферийными устройствами. Это форма регрессионного тестирования, которая проверяет новые версии оборудования с более старым программным обеспечением.